Transaction 93b20ef45dd307c2626c9907de41bafbb6fefb5c3a5898edafca030fc770e010

3 Input
2 Outputs
  • 93b20ef45dd307c2626c9907de41bafbb6fefb5c3a5898edafca030fc770e010:0
  • value  1510000000
    address  1JoUqT9LvMh32znJTZVNQFhDN7XvjPToQP
  • 93b20ef45dd307c2626c9907de41bafbb6fefb5c3a5898edafca030fc770e010:1
  • value  189876194
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F